csdn_sqj 2019-12-28 09:46 采纳率: 40%
浏览 676
已结题

ssm项目,怎么验证存放在mysql里的登录的用户信息?

有点复杂,请大神耐心看
+++++++++++++++++++++
一、我现在想尝试从mysql里获取用户信息并且验证它
图片说明
假设:我现在输入了-->用户名:aaa; 密码:aaa
数据库里有这个用户;
那么要怎么把这个结果(包括权限power:根据游客、管理者等不同的身份而拥有不同的权利)返回给springmvc呢?
或者说怎么获取数据库返回的信息呢?
|
我的想法是:

  • 根据输入的账号密码,让数据库返回一些内容,再根据内容做判断。

+++++++++++++++++++++++++

二、如果我这个设计思路有问题,请大神纠正,谢谢

  • 写回答

1条回答 默认 最新

  • threenewbee 2019-12-28 10:40
    关注

    完整的例子:
    https://www.cnblogs.com/535812068wh/p/9565078.html

    作为实验的程序,密码明文保存也无妨(即便csdn这种商业网站,在10年以前都是明文保存密码),当你掌握了基本的写法,再完善就简单了。你的目的是一开始学会如何查询数据库,传入参数和返回结果,把流程走通。不要一开始把问题复杂化,被一堆你现在还难以掌握的名词搞得晕头转向。你只要查询数据库,传入用户名密码,判断数据库里面是否能找到记录,找到就是登录成功,返回用户信息,否则就是失败。你先看下我给你的文章。

    评论

报告相同问题?

悬赏问题

  • ¥15 用visual studi code完成html页面
  • ¥15 聚类分析或者python进行数据分析
  • ¥15 逻辑谓词和消解原理的运用
  • ¥15 三菱伺服电机按启动按钮有使能但不动作
  • ¥15 js,页面2返回页面1时定位进入的设备
  • ¥50 导入文件到网吧的电脑并且在重启之后不会被恢复
  • ¥15 (希望可以解决问题)ma和mb文件无法正常打开,打开后是空白,但是有正常内存占用,但可以在打开Maya应用程序后打开场景ma和mb格式。
  • ¥20 ML307A在使用AT命令连接EMQX平台的MQTT时被拒绝
  • ¥20 腾讯企业邮箱邮件可以恢复么
  • ¥15 有人知道怎么将自己的迁移策略布到edgecloudsim上使用吗?